Web19 aug. 2024 · Men (79% of 38,364) die by suicide at a rate four times higher than women ( Mental Health America [MHA], 2024 ). They also die due to alcohol-related causes at 62,000 in comparison to women at 26,000. Men are also two to three times more likely to misuse drugs than women ( Center for Behavioral Health Statistics and Quality, 2024 ).

In the first year of the COVID-19 pandemic, global prevalence of anxiety and depression increased by a massive 25%, according to a scientific brief released by the World Health Organization (WHO) today.
